Grab a 930 part number Carrera wing and have the wiper hole shaved and the center vent paint matched to look like an RS America tail. Nearly impossible to tell the difference from the outside and thousands less than a real RSA wing.

I have the RSA tail on my C2 and it made a considerable improvement at high speeds on tracks like VIR and WGI. Especially cross winds if you want more the 3.8RS bi wing adds downforce which is quite noticeable. You can buy RSA wings new from Porsche for around $2800 or so. They are sold as the Carrera wing but are supplied minus the hole for the wiper. You will still need to source a lid and brackets. The RSA wing does weigh 6 pounds more than the motorized stock lid.
